  • Abstract
    This paper provides a systematic guidance for linear switched reluctance machine design. By classifying the feasible polygons for desired machine operations, the physical size limits of either longitudinal or transverse flux linear machine poles and pole pitches can be determined. Also, with appropriate objective function selections, the constraints for associated machine optimization studies can be defined from the polygon boundaries. Comparison verifications are provided to show the adequacies and capabilities of the proposed algorithms
